The Thorough Control System also includes Telecine set up negative film strips of each film negative stock (35/16, Kodak, Fuji, Ilford) for use by the telecine facility. As we all know, all existing film negative stocks were designed differently and therefore require different adjustments during the telecine transfer. Those strips are exposed under strict photometry conditions (3200K or 5500K) and optical densities checked by densitometer. Telecine set up negative film strips are a negative image of the chart similar to Cinematographer's Color Chart. The only difference is the shape and size of 45 IRE and color.

This has been redesigned for convenience of color correction operations for telecine colorists. These negative strips may be purchased together with chart or separately. Telecine set up film strips on positive and intermediate stocks are also available. We recommend the use of these filmstrips (at least one negative) with the chart to utilize the Thorough Control System fully. Many of our clients, especially commercial and television cinematographers, have their own library of our Telecine set up negative film strips. When they are working in many different telecine facilities, they loan their strips to the facilities during the production or transfer.
